순차탐색이나 이진 탐색을 하기 위해서는 탐색하고자 하는 대상 데이터의 정렬 여부를 확인하여 탐색방법을 선택하는 것이 맞는지? 아니면 맞지 않는지? 논의하시오. ... 순차탐색이나 이진 탐색을 하기 위해서는 탐색하고자 하는 대상 데이터의 정렬 여부를 확인하여 탐색방법을 선택하는 것이 맞는지? 아니면 맞지 않는지? 논의하시오. ... 순차탐색은 데이터 배열 처음부터 끝까지 비교하며 탐색하는 탐색 방법으로 n개의 데이터에 대해 평균 (n+1)/2의 탐색을, 최악의 경우 n번의 비교가 필요하다.
인덱스 세트에서 순차 세트 방향으로 단계를 거쳐 반복하여 결과를 얻는다. ① 초기 루트 노드 값 N(30)부터 시작 ② 탐색키값 V(20)과 비교하여 큰 탐색키 중 작은 키 K _{ ... 또한, leaf는 순차세트이며, 모두 list 연결되어 있다. - leaf가 아닌 노드에 탐색키값 수는 서브트리 수보다 하나 적다. - leaf는 최소 ┍(차수-1)/2┑개의 탐색키값을 ... 힙 파일 구조는 특정한 순서에 관계없이 임의의 공간에 저장하는 비순서 구조이며, 순차 파일은 탐색키 기준 순서로 정렬되어 저장되고, 해시 파일 구조는 해시 함수를 기반으로 저장 위치를
; // 이진 탐색 방법과 순차적 탐색 방법의 측정 시간을 저장할 변수 선언 void main() { char *eng[101]; //영어단어를 저장할 포인터배열 선언 char *kor ... 이용해 검색 된 단어를 찾는 함수 int search2(char **, char *, int); //순차적 탐색을 이용해 검색 된 단어를 찾는 함수 double time1, time2 ... int); //사전적 순서에 맞게 나열하는 함수 void print(char **, int); //출력함수 int search1(char **, char *, int); //이진탐색을
순차탐색의 과정 1. ... 순차탐색 ① 순차탐색 - 파일에 저장된 데이터들을 따로 재구성 해야할 필요가 없으므로 가장 간단하게 구현할 수 있다. - 임의의 순서대로 데이터들이 나열된 경우에는 유일한 탐색방법으로 ... 파일의 마지막 레코드의 키도 찾고자 하는 값과 같지 않다면 탐색을 종료한다 ③ 순차탐색의 효율성 : n 개의 데이터가 저장되어 있는 파일로부터의 탐색 - 주어진 파일로부터 특정한 키를
탐색의 의미 ? 순차탐색 방법 설명(+ 배열의 의미 복습) ? ... 순차탐색 방법을 이해하고 스스로 순서도 그려보기 ? 2진 탐색과정으로 다른 숫자 찾아보기 ? ... 순차탐색방법의 장단점 - 알고리즘이 단순하고 간단하여 적은 자료를 탐색하기에는 효과적이나 자료가 많아질수록 비효율적. ?
[순차탐색]다음 프로그램은 순차탐색 알고리즘을 구현한 것이다. 순차탐색이란 배열에 저장된 숫자와 찾고자 하는 숫자와 하나씩 순차적으로 비교해서 탐색하는 알고리즘을 의미한다. ... 6.실제 수행되는 문장의 횟수를 알아보기 위하여 순차탐색 코드를 다음과 같이 수정하여 수행하여 보라. ... 위의 프로그램에 순차탐색 대신에 다음의 이진 탐색 알고리즘을 삽입하여 수행시간을 측정하여 보라.
지금부터 순차적으로 정렬된 배열에서 한 개의 원하는 값에 대한 탐색을 하는 클래스를 짜보고자 한다....1. ... (순환 함수))Sequential Search : 순차탐색위의 세가지 테스트를 실제로 수행하는 클래스와 테스트를 시작하고 종료하는 매니저 클래스를 만들기로 했다. ... 탐색방법▪ 다음은 과제에서 요구한 3가지의 탐색 함수 메커니즘이다.Binary Search : 이진 탐색(일반 함수)Recursive Binary Search : 이진 탐색(재귀 함수
본 연구는 웹 기반 수업 개발을 위한 ‘인쇄물 기반의 래피드 프로토타입 개발 방법론’의 세부적인 단계와 단계간의 연관성을 규명함과 동시에 이 방법론의 효과성과 개선 방향을 탐색하기 ... 전통적인 ISD의 순차적 개발 과정에 따른 문제점을 극복하는 한 가지 대안으로 제시된 래피드 프로토타입 개발 방법론은 웹 기반 수업 개발 과정에도 적용될 수 있지만, 아직까지 종이를
다만 이진탐색알고리즘은 정렬된 값에서만 적용될 수 있다. -- 순차탐색 알고리즘 순차탐색 알고리즘은 선형 탐색알고리즘이라고도 한다. ... 순차탐색 알고리즘은 어떠한 값들의 나열에서 찾고자 하는 값을 맨 앞에서부터 끝까지 차례대로 찾아 나가는 것이다. ... 알고리즘 탐색알고리즘을 쓰는 이유는 방대한 데이터에서 목적에 맞는 데이터를 찾기 위함이다. -- 이진 탐색 알고리즘 이진 탐색 알고리즘은 오름차순으로 정렬된 것에서 특정한 값의 위치를
순차세트의 단말 노드는 적어도 (n-1)/2 개의 탐색키를 포함하며, 탐색키에 대한 실제 레코드를 지칭하는 포인터를 제공한다. ... 순차 파일의 종류로는 레코드가 시스템에 삽입되는 순서대로 만들어지는 파일인 엔트리 순차 파일과 레코드들의 키 값의 순서대로 만들어지는 파일인 키 순차 파일이 있다. ... 순차세트는 단말 노드로 구성되어 있으며, 모든 노드가 순차적으로 서로 연결되어 있다.
순차(Sequential) 파일 구조 순차 파일 구조는 레코드들이 탐색키의 값을 기준으로 정렬하여 저장하는 구조이다. ... 레코드 탐색 시 모든 레코드 들을 순차적으로 접근해야 하며, 삭제 시 삭제된 레코드가 있었던 블록에 빈공간이 생기기 때문에 주기적인 순차 파일 재구성이 필요하다. ... 순차 세트는 탐색키에 대한 실제 레코드를 지칭하고 있는 포인터를 제공하며 적어도 (n-1)/2개의 탐색키를 포함한다. 2) 검색 특정한 탐색키 값을 검색하게 되면 B ^{+}-트리에서
순차 세트는 모든 노드가 연결 리스트 형태로 순차적으로 연결되어 있어 저장된 레코드를 탐색키값 순서에 따라 효율적으로 접근할 수 있도록 한다. ... B+-트리는 인덱스 세트와 순차 세트 두 부분으로 구성되는데 인덱스 세트의 탐색키값은 단말 노드에 있는 탐색키값을 신속하게 찾아갈 수 있는 경로를 제공한다. ... 순차파일 구조는 레코드들이 특정 컬럼에 대한 값을 기준으로 정렬되어 저장되며, 보통 정렬키로 탐색키를 사용한다.
정리하면 힙파일구조는 저장은 빠르지만 탐색이 느리고, 반대로 순차파일 구조는 저장은 느리지만 탐색이 빠르다는 특징이 있다.. ... B+ 트리에서의 검색 특정 탐색키값에 해당하기 위해서는 인덱스 세트를 통해 경로를 구하고, 순차 세트에서 탐색키에 해당하는 포인터를 찾아야한다. ... 또 순차파일은 레코드에 직접접근이 어려운 반면 해시파일구조는 레코드에 직접 접근이 가능하지만 순차적 접근이 비효율적인 특징이 있다. Q2.